Masonry stair repair services involve restoring and maintaining the structural integrity and appearance of outdoor or indoor staircases constructed from stone, brick, or concrete. These services typically include fixing cracks, chips, or crumbling sections, as well as replacing damaged treads or risers.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ques to ensure that repairs blend seamlessly with the existing materials, helping to preserve the original look of the stairs while making them safe and functional again. Regular maintenance and timely repairs can prevent small issues from developing into more serious problems that could compromise safety or lead to costly replacements.
Stairs that are made of masonry materials are prone to various problems over time, especially in areas with harsh weather conditions like those in Catonsville, MD. Common issues include cracked or uneven steps caused by settling or shifting ground, loose or crumbling mortar joints, and surface deterioration from freeze-thaw cycles. These problems not only affect the visual appeal of a property but can also pose safety hazards, such as tripping or falling. Masonry stair repair services help address these issues by stabilizing the structure, filling in cracks, and restoring the stairs to a safe and stable condition.

The overview below groups typical Masonry Stair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Catonsville,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or masonry stair repairs in Catonsville range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ing a few damaged treads or repairing cracks,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Moderate Repairs - more extensive repairs, like rebuilding sections of stairs or replacing multiple steps, often cost between $600 and $1,500. Larger projects that involve significant structural work can push costs toward the upper part of this range.
Full Replacement - replacing entire staircases generally costs from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on size and materials. Many full replacements fall within the middle to upper end of this range, with larger or more complex projects reaching higher costs.
Complex or Custom Projects - custom designs or stairs with intricate features can exceed $5,000, especially if additional structural reinforcement or unique materials are needed. Such projects are less common and t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ry stair repairs do local contractors handle? Local contractors typically repair cracked or crumbling steps, replace damaged treads, and restore the structural integrity of masonry stairs in residential and commercial properties.
How can I tell if my masonry stairs need repair? Signs that stairs may need repair include visible cracks, loose or shifting steps, uneven surfaces, or deterioration of mortar joints.
Are there different materials used for masonry stair repair? Yes, repair materials can include mortar, concrete, or stone, depending on the original construction and the extent of damage.
What are common causes of masonry stair damage? Common causes include freeze-thaw cycles, ground settling, heavy use, and exposure to moisture leading to deterioration.
How do local service providers ensure the durability of masonry stair repairs? Contractors typically clean, assess, and carefully match repair materials to existing stairs to restore strength and appearance effectively.
